Description

St Coletta Of Wi Blackhawk 2 is an assisted living community in Waukesha, WI that offers a range of amenities and care services to ensure the comfort and well-being of its residents. The community features a spacious dining room where residents can enjoy their meals, which are specially prepared to accommodate any dietary restrictions they may have. Each living space is fully furnished, providing a cozy and convenient environment for the residents.

A beautiful garden and outdoor space are available for residents to relax and enjoy nature. Housekeeping services are provided to maintain cleanliness and tidiness within the community. Residents can stay connected with family and friends through telephone and Wi-Fi/high-speed internet access.

The caring staff at St Coletta Of Wi Blackhawk 2 offers ass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. They coordinate with health care providers to ensure that residents receive the necessary medical attention. Additionally, medication management services are provided to help residents take their medications on time.

Residents can participate in scheduled daily activities, fostering social engagement and promoting a sense of community within the facility. Transportation arrangements are available for medical appointments, ensuring that residents can easily access necessary healthcare services.

Convenience is key at St Coletta Of Wi Blackhawk 2, with numerous c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, theaters, and hospitals located nearby. This allows residents to easily explore the surrounding area or seek additional amenities or medical assistance as needed.

Overall, St Coletta Of Wi Blackhawk 2 provides a comfortable assisted living experience with comprehensive care services and a variety of nearby amenities for its residents in Waukesha, WI.

Nearby Places of Interest

This part of Waukesha, Wisconsin is a convenient and accessible location for senior living, with easy access to pharmacies such as Meijer Pharmacy, Walgreens, and Walmart Pharmacy for any medical needs. There are also several reputable physicians in the area, including Prohealth Care Medical Associates and West Suburban Center For Arthritis. In terms of dining options, there are familiar choices like McDonald's and Culver's nearby. Residents can also find cafes like Mama D's Coffee and Panera Bread within a short drive. For recreation and relaxation, there are parks like Glacier Cone Park and Fox Brook Park nearby, along with theaters like Silverspot Cinema for entertainment options. Additionally, there are places of worship such as First Congregational Church for spiritual support. Overall, this area offers a diverse range of amenities and services that cater to the needs of seniors looking for a comfortable living environment in Waukesha.
